PUNCH ROMAINE

Originally a slushie of sorts devised by the legendary chef Escoffier, Punch Romaine is perhaps best remembered, according to Talia Baiocchi and Leslie Pariseau in their book, "Spritz," as "the sixth course of the Titanic's final first-class dinner." If you can get past the drink's tragic history, this updated version (adapted from Spritz) is beautiful - and beautifully refreshing.

Provided by Rosie Schaap

Categories     cocktails

Number Of Ingredients 7



Punch Romaine image

Steps:

  • Combine egg white, rum, simple syrup, lemon juice and orange juice in a cocktail shaker. Shake without ice, then add ice to the shaker, and shake again until chilled. Strain into a snifter filled with crushed ice, and top with Champagne. Garnish with orange peel.

1 egg white
1 oz. white rum
1/2 oz. simple syrup
1/2 oz. fresh lemon juice
1 oz. fresh orange juice
Champagne
Orange peel

LEMON TABOULI WITH TENDER ROMAINE

This tabouli is excellent with or without the romaine lettuce. To make this a meal, you could add some chopped grilled chicken. From Epicurious.com, September 2003. Paula Wolfert: "A few years ago, when I was in southeastern Turkey working on my book Mediterranean Grains and Greens, I noticed that the women didn't soak their bulgur in water for some summer preparations. When I asked a Turkish friend about this, she let out a laugh. "In Turkey, no man would marry a woman who just used water! For cold bulgur dishes we always soak in tomato juice, onion juice, or fresh pressed and strained sour grape juice to flavor the bulgur first.""

Provided by swissms

Categories     Low Protein

Time 2h

Yield 4 cups,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11



Lemon Tabouli With Tender Romaine image

Steps:

  • Place the bulgur in a fine sieve, rinse under cold running water, squeeze dry, and soak in the lemon juice for 45 minutes. Use a fork to fluff the bulgur.
  • In a bowl, combine the tomatoes, scallions, cinnamon, and a few pinches of salt and pepper. Drizzle on the olive oil and toss. Fold in the bulgur, parsley, and mint and mix well. Refrigerate, stirring occasionally.
  • Taste and correct the flavors with lemon juice, salt, and pepper. Serve with crisp inner leaves of romaine lettuce for scooping up the salad.

1/2 cup fine grain # 1 bulgur
1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
2 cups finely diced tomatoes
1/2 cup thinly sliced scallion
2 pinches ground cinnamon
salt
fresh ground pepper
1/3 cup extra virgin olive oil
2 cups finely chopped flat leaf parsley
2 tablespoons slivered fresh mint leaves (optional)
tender romaine leaf

248 - MARASCHINO PUNCH - ROMAINE
2 cups water. 1 cup sugar.. 1/2 a lemon - juice only. 1/2 an orange - juice only. 1/2 cup of maraschino - large.. 2 whites of eggs.. Mix all, except the whites, together cold, strain into a freezer, freeze as usual, whip the whites firm and stir in and beat up well and freeze again.It is a snow-white ice, rich and tenacious like pulled candy, The fruit juices are not essential, but an …

THE CLASSIC COLLECTION PUNCH ROMAINE | MOëT & CHANDON
The history of this punch can be traced back to the 1790s. Its popularity was such that it even featured in a Swedish cookery book published in 1808! We have famous French chef Auguste Escoffier to thank for this version, which was famously served as a stand-alone sixth course to first-class passengers on the night the Titanic sunk.

PUNCH A LA ROMAINE - ROMAN PUNCH ICE - N. B - CHESTOFBOOKS.COM
Punch A La Romaine - Roman Punch Ice. Make a quart of lemon ice, and flavour it with a glass or two of each, of rum, brandy, champagne, and Maraschino; when it is frozen, to each quart take the whites of five eggs and whip them to a very strong froth; boil half a pound of sugar to the ball, and rub it with a spoon or spatula against the sides to grain it; when it turns white, mix it quickly ...
